SPECIAL CONDITIONS FOR <br /> 2015 AMGEN TOUR OF CALIFORNIA <br /> ENCROACHMENT PERMIT <br /> 1. Traffic control shall be in accordance with the attached traffic management plan. <br /> 2. Applicant shall furnish and maintain any and all traffic control devices necessary to ensure the <br /> protection of the traveling public in accordance with the traffic management plan. <br /> 3. Traffic handling at intersections shall be provided by California Highway Patrol and/or the Motor <br /> Marshals. <br /> 4. Delays to the travelling public shall be kept to a minimum. <br /> 5. Applicant will immediately make such repairs or perform any necessary work as required to leave <br /> the portion of the County Highway system used for the event in as neat, clean, and usable <br /> condition as existed prior to event. <br /> 6. Applicant shall contact and coordinate with the railroad companies whose tracks will be crossed <br /> by the event. <br /> 7.
